[Asia Economy Honam Reporting Headquarters Reporter Kim Jaegil] Gochang-gun, Jeonbuk, is taking active measures to support young people facing difficulties due to COVID-19.


On the 2nd, Gochang-gun announced that it will provide the ‘Saengsaeng Support Fund’ for living stability to 30 unemployed youths, with a project budget of 100 million won.


The ‘Saengsaeng Support Fund’ is a project that provides 500,000 won per month for up to 3 months to young people who have been unemployed for more than one month after working part-time, short-term, daily labor, or part-time jobs at workplaces not covered by employment insurance, etc.


In addition, to alleviate the management burden of youth businesses and promote new employment of unemployed youth, the project temporarily supports monthly labor costs of 2 million won (including 20% employer contribution) for part-time workers at youth businesses for up to 4 months.


Since the 25th of last month, recruitment for each project has been underway targeting youths aged 18 to 39 residing in Gochang-gun.


Youth unemployed persons can apply for the Saengsaeng Support Fund until the 14th, and youth businesses can apply until the 10th through the Jeonbuk Youth Hub Center website.
